Description

Energy-saving fan heater blade convenient to dismantle and wash
Technical Field
The utility model relates to a fan heater technical field specifically is a be convenient for dismantle abluent energy-saving fan heater blade.
Background
With the gradual arrival of winter, the temperature in northern areas gradually drops, and people can use various heating devices for heating, wherein the fan heater is a very common one, and the inside of the fan heater is composed of a plurality of parts, wherein the blades are important, but the existing fan heater blades have certain defects, such as:
1. most of blades of the existing fan heater are arranged in the fan heater in a bolt manner, and the blades are troublesome to disassemble, so that a user cannot conveniently disassemble and clean the blades;
2. the rotation angle of the blades of the existing fan heater is mostly fixed, and the rotation angle of the blades cannot be adjusted according to the requirements of users, so that the change of the warm air area of the whole device is realized.
Aiming at the problems, innovative design is urgently needed on the basis of the original fan heater blade structure.

Referring to fig. 1-5, the present invention provides a technical solution: an energy-saving fan heater blade convenient to disassemble and clean comprises a machine body butt joint block 1, a containing groove 2, a blind groove 3, a magnet 4, an installation block 5, a limiting block 6, a butt joint blade 7, a bevel gear 8, a sliding groove 9, a movable gear ring 10, a sliding block 11 and a butterfly bolt 12, wherein the containing groove 2 is formed in the inner side of the machine body butt joint block 1, the blind groove 3 is formed in the inner side of the containing groove 2, the blind groove 3 is connected with the inner surface of the machine body butt joint block 1, the installation block 5 is installed on the inner side of the machine body butt joint block 1, the limiting block 6 is fixedly connected to the outer side of the installation block 5, the limiting block 6 is connected with the containing groove 2, the magnet 4 is fixedly connected to the outer side of the limiting block 6 and the inner side of the blind groove 3, the butt joint blade 7 is installed on the outer side of the installation block 5, and the upper end of the sliding chute 9 is provided with a movable gear ring 10, the lower end of the movable gear ring 10 is fixedly connected with a slide block 11, the slide block 11 is connected with the mounting block 5, the outer side of the movable gear ring 10 is provided with a butterfly bolt 12, and the butterfly bolt 12 is connected with the mounting block 5.
3 blind grooves 3 are symmetrically arranged about the central point of the machine body butt joint block 1, the blind grooves 3 are of arc-shaped structures, the blind grooves 3 are communicated with the accommodating groove 2, and after the installation block 5 is in butt joint with the machine body butt joint block 1, the mounting block can be stably and fixedly installed through the limiting state between the limiting block 6 and the blind grooves 3;
the limiting block 6 is in an L-shaped structure, the limiting block 6 and the inner side of the machine body butt joint block 1 form a dismounting and mounting structure through the accommodating groove 2, the limiting block 6 and the blind groove 3 form a clamping structure through the magnet 4, the mounting block 5 can move, and meanwhile, the limiting block 6 and the inner side of the machine body butt joint block 1 can be stably clamped and mounted through the 3 limiting blocks 6;
the butt-joint blades 7 are distributed on the outer side of the mounting block 5 in an equal angle mode, the butt-joint blades 7 and the outer end of the mounting block 5 form a rotating structure through the bevel gear 8, the butt-joint blades 7 distributed in an equal angle mode can stably rotate along the outer end of the mounting block 5, and therefore heating work of different areas is achieved;
the movable gear ring 10 is of a circular structure, the movable gear ring 10 and the outer side of the mounting block 5 form a rotating structure through the sliding groove 9, the movable gear ring 10 is in meshed connection with the bevel gear 8, and the mounting block 5 can be driven by the meshed bevel gear 8 to synchronously rotate at an angle while the movable gear ring 10 rotates;
the butterfly bolts 12 are symmetrically arranged about the central point of the mounting block 5 in number 3, the mounting block 5 and the movable gear ring 10 form a dismounting and mounting structure through the butterfly bolts 12, and a user can conveniently limit and fix the rotating range of the movable gear ring 10 through the butterfly bolts 12.
When the energy-saving fan heater blade convenient to disassemble and clean is used, according to the figures 1, 3 and 5, the device is firstly placed at a position needing to work, when a user needs to disassemble and clean the butt joint blade 7 after the device works for a period of time, firstly, the preset cover body on the outer side of the butt joint block 1 of the machine body is disassembled, then the installation block 5 is held by hand to rotate along the inner side of the butt joint block 1 of the machine body, at the moment, 3 'L' -shaped limiting blocks 6 on the outer side of the installation block 5 are separated from a limiting state between the limiting blocks and the blind groove 3, meanwhile, the attraction state between the limiting blocks and the magnet 4 is disconnected, then the limiting blocks 6 are rotated to correspond to the position of the accommodating groove 2 by the user, and at the moment, the user can conveniently disassemble and clean the middle end of the butt joint block 1 of the machine body by holding the installation block 5 provided with the butt joint blade 7;
according to the figures 1, 2, 4 and 5, after the user finishes cleaning the installation block 5 provided with the butt joint blades 7, the butterfly bolts 12 limiting the movable gear ring 10 can be disassembled, then the movable gear ring 10 in a handheld state can rotate along the outer side of the installation block 5 through the sliding grooves 9, at the moment, the movable gear ring can drive the bevel gears 8 meshed with the outer sides to synchronously rotate in a circumferential mode, and further the butt joint blades 7 fixed at the outer ends of the bevel gears 8 are driven to synchronously adjust the angle, after the position of the movable gear ring is determined, the movable gear ring 10 is limited in position through the butterfly bolts 12 3 again, the adjusting angle of the butt joint blades 7 can be conveniently limited and fixed, and therefore the user can conveniently adjust and change the warm air area of the whole device as required, and the practicability of the whole device is improved.
